Heat a medium saucepan over medium and add the butter, swirling to melt. When the butter is foaming, sprinkle in the flour, whisking constantly to work out any lumps. Reduce the heat to medium-low and continue to cook the butter and flour mixture, whisking constantly, until it’s the color of a latte, 5 to 7 minutes. Claire Saffitz is the bestselling author of Dessert Person and host of the cookbook companion YouTube series Dessert Person. After graduating from Harvard University, she received a master's degree in culinary history from McGill in Montreal and then studied pastry in Paris at École Grégoire Ferrandi.
